February 26, 2019Walmart Surges After Reporting Best Holiday Quarter Since 2009
Walmart Inc. finally gave the U.S. retail sector some good news. The company brushed off the industry’s disappointing December sales with its best holiday quarter in at least a decade, soothing concerns about the sector’s outlook for 2019. Comparable sales for Walmart stores in the United States — a key performance barometer — rose 4.2% in the quarter that included Christmas, beating analysts’ estimates by a full percentage point.
